DONOR Burma/Myanmar Konbaung Period, 18th Century Wood, red lacquer originally gilded h. 19 1/16 in., w. 14 1/4 in., d. 9 7/8 in. Gift of Konrad and Sarah Bekker, 1986 BC86.01.02.00 |
Standing Donor King, with crown and royal robes. Here the worshipping King is a standing figure with hands in the attitude of reverence and held against chest, in anjali mudra. The image is dark red with traces of gold leaf especially on the crown which has a petal-like design. The king wears royal robes. He is standing on a semi-circular base with nine lotus flowers carved on the sides.
